1. After starting PolCycleTime, switch to the Price and demand calculations tab.
  2. In the tab select new empty project (with variants wizard)
  3. Then you must first specify where the new project (the project file) should be saved
  4. Now you will be navigated through the individual inputs/decisions one after the other (wizard pages). Note: You can also "leave open" the following inputs/decisions and then edit them later. The sequence of the inputs/decisions also leads, among other things, to the fact that corresponding orientation values are calculated at the corresponding points and offered for selection/acceptance. If corresponding inputs are missing, no orientation values may be displayed. 
    1. Page 1: enter a designation for the first variant and select the background color (this is for a better overview if you want to edit more than one variant in a project)
    2. Page 2: enter the inputs/decisions for production method and production precision
    3. Page 3: enter the inputs/decisions on quantities and scrap
    4. Page 4: enter the inputs/decisions for machine running time and cycle time
    5. Page 5: enter the inputs/decisions for mold, cavity numbers and mold costs
    6. Page 6: enter the inputs/decisions on wear 
    7. last, a note appears that the inputs/decisions for production, material and QA costs are not entered within the wizard. You can then edit this data.
  1. The variant is now added to the project and the project window opens. Your inputs as well as the results (if already possible) are displayed



  1. If necessary, edit the inputs and decisions that are still open. Text  1  is marked in red as long as inputs are still missing or incorrect.
